Job Summary The Tendering Manager – Fitout is responsible for managing the complete tendering process for interior fit-out and refurbishment projects. This role ensures accurate cost estimation, competitive pricing, and timely submission of high-quality tenders in line with client requirements and company objectives.
Key Responsibilities Tender Management Manage the full tender lifecycle from enquiry receipt to final submission and post-tender clarification Review tender documents, drawings, specifications, BOQs, and scope of works Prepare tender programs, submission schedules, and resource plans
Cost Estimation & Pricing Lead preparation of detailed cost estimates for interior fit-out works (commercial, residential, hospitality, retail) Analyze drawings and specifications to identify risks, value engineering options, and cost efficiencies Prepare competitive pricing strategies while maintaining target margins
Subcontractor & Supplier Coordination Identify, pre-qualify, and negotiate with subcontractors and suppliers Obtain and evaluate quotations to ensure technical and commercial compliance Maintain an up-to-date subcontractor and supplier database
Commercial & Technical Coordination Work closely with design, procurement, and project teams to ensure tender accuracy Participate in pre-bid meetings, site visits, and tender clarification meetings Prepare technical submissions, method statements, and value engineering proposals
Risk & Compliance Identify commercial, contractual, and technical risks within tenders Ensure tenders comply with contractual terms, client requirements, and company policies Support contract negotiations and handover to project execution teams
Team Leadership & Reporting Lead and mentor estimators and tender engineers Track tender performance, win/loss ratios, and market trends Prepare management reports and tender status updates
